DISSIPATIVE DIVERGENCE OF RESONANT ORBITS [PDF]

open access: yesThe Astronomical Journal, 2012
A considerable fraction of multi-planet systems discovered by the observational surveys of extrasolar planets reside in mild proximity to first-order mean motion resonances. However, the relative remoteness of such systems from nominal resonant period ratios (e.g. 2:1, 3:2, 4:3) has been interpreted as evidence for lack of resonant interactions.

Are the Kepler Near-Resonance Planet Pairs due to Tidal Dissipation? [PDF]

open access: yes, 2013
The multiple-planet systems discovered by the Kepler mission show an excess of planet pairs with period ratios just wide of exact commensurability for first-order resonances like 2:1 and 3:2.
